Stand-Alone vs. Slave Units

This is something that trips up the lot of individuals whenever they first appear into purchasing a ghl doser . You'll see "Stand-Alone" models and "Slave" (or Extension) models.

The Stand-Alone unit is the brains of the procedure. It has the built-in controller and the particular Wi-Fi chip. You can run everything by itself without needing a Profilux controller. The Slave units, however, are usually just the penis pumps. They have to be plugged into the Stand-Alone unit or a Profilux via a PAB (ProfiLux Automated Bus) cable.

I started with a 4-pump Stand-Alone unit. Later on on, as our tank grew and I started attempting to dose more things—like trace elements, proteins, and even liquefied food—I just additional an extension unit. It's a modular system, which means you don't have to buy more "brains" than you actually need. You just chain them collectively. The PAB Program is a casino game Player

Talking about the particular PAB system, it's actually among the best parts of the particular GHL ecosystem. It's basically a conversation protocol that lets all your GHL gear talk to each other without interference. Unlike various other brands that use standard USB wires (which aren't really designed for the salty environment under the fish tank), the particular PAB cables are usually robust and created for this specific purpose. I've in no way a new "communication error" or even a signal drop-out, which is more compared to I can say for some of the other clever gear I've possessed.

It Does More Than Just Alk and California

While most people get a ghl doser intended for the "big three" (Alkalinity, Calcium, plus Magnesium), I've discovered it's useful regarding a lot more. Since the particular pumps are incredibly exact, I use one of mine for dosing concentrated aminos. I actually only need the tiny amount every single day, and carrying it out by hand will be a chore I always forget.

Some people actually use these with regard to automatic water adjustments (AWC). You can arranged one pump in order to pull out a few liters of outdated water and an additional to push in the same amount associated with fresh saltwater all through the day. This keeps your salinity and mineral amounts rock-solid. Because the particular GHL motors are rated for continuous duty much better than most, they can manage the longer work times required regarding AWC without burning up out.
